单元测试和其他代码一起放在版本控制下是更好的做法,因为它有以下优点:
在版本控制下,每个人都可以看到源代码的完整历史记录,这有助于团队协作,确保所有团队成员的工作都是一致的。而将单元测试与代码一起放在版本控制下,可以让你了解代码是如何随着时间的推移而变化的,从而更好地理解和维护代码。
版本控制下的单元测试可以帮助你检查测试是否覆盖了所有可能的代码路径。如果你对某个代码路径进行了修改,而忘记了编写相应的单元测试来测试新功能,版本控制下的单元测试可以提醒你编写相应的测试。
版本控制下的单元测试可以帮助你快速地回归测试代码,如果你对代码进行了更改并且没有相应地更新单元测试,你可以回滚到前面的代码版本并运行单元测试以确认代码是否符合预期。
综上所述,将单元测试和其余代码一起保持在版本控制下,可以有效提高代码质量、协作和代码覆盖率,这对于一个软件开发团队是至关重要的。
领取专属 10元无门槛券
手把手带您无忧上云